Geologically, a high island or volcanic island is an island of volcanic origin. The term can be used to distinguish such islands from low islands, which are formed from sedimentation or the uplifting of coral reefs (which have often formed on sunken volcanos).

WebThe Jeju Volcanic Island and Lava Tubes is a World Heritage Site in South Korea. ... Baengnokdam (Hangul: 백록담), the crater, and lake in it are located at the peak of Hallasan, which was formed over 25,000 years ago. Jeju is scientifically valuable for its extensive system of lava tubes ...
